Transaction 18d7b58873c74cb50376817af0e75642062fae600403888c911de72344d86508

4 Input
2 Outputs
  • 18d7b58873c74cb50376817af0e75642062fae600403888c911de72344d86508:0
  • value  4807137
    address  1JzzPKwCgY5iymgzmCQcg3pmCD9jJ4q7Rc
  • 18d7b58873c74cb50376817af0e75642062fae600403888c911de72344d86508:1
  • value  8981000
    address  3QhZpuaexq6Sh2PxXbJHoygeeDSR7jHZgh